Master Atisha was born in Bangladesh as a prince. He was endowed with many exceptional and interesting dispositions and unsurpassed wisdom. At the age of 3, he had mastered arithmetic and languages. At the age of 6, he attained a profound understanding of the Dharma. By the age of 20, he was highly proficient in the Dharma, music, poetry, literature, medicine, the arts, debate, logic, and all forms of knowledge. He became a highly accomplished scholar.
At the age of 11, after travelling to Nalanda Buddhist University in India to visit the great masters, wherever a great master resided, Master Astisha would travel there to learn from him. He travelled overseas three times to seek teachers and learn the teachings. He even travelled to Indonesia and learned from Master Serlingba for 12 years.
After more than 10 years of diligent learning and practice, and having followed 153 great masters, his learning was akin to filling water from one water bottle to another. He attained all the Mahayana, Hinayana, Tantra and Mantra lineage teachings, becoming India’s most well-versed and influential guiding Master among all different sects, and an authority on all schools of thought.
In his old age, he arrived to Tibet to assist to revive and propagate Buddhism, henceforth, making outstanding contributions to the development of Buddhism in China.
